设计和实现可靠的 WebSocket 实时通信系统。
Workflow
- 需求分析 — 通信模式 (点对点/广播/房间)、消息格式
- 选择方案 — Socket.IO / ws / 原生 WebSocket
- 设计协议 — 消息类型、心跳、重连
- 实现服务 — 连接管理、消息路由、房间管理
- 部署运维 — 负载均衡、水平扩展、监控
核心实现
Socket.IO Server (Node.js)
const { Server } = require('socket.io');
const io = new Server(httpServer, {
cors: { origin: '*' },
pingTimeout: 60000,
pingInterval: 25000,
});
// 房间管理
io.on('connection', (socket) => {
console.log(`User connected: ${socket.id}`);
// 加入房间
socket.on('join:room', (roomId) => {
socket.join(roomId);
socket.to(roomId).emit('user:joined', { userId: socket.id });
});
// 房间消息
socket.on('message:room', ({ roomId, message }) => {
io.to(roomId).emit('message:new', {
userId: socket.id,
message,
timestamp: Date.now(),
});
});
// 私聊
socket.on('message:private', ({ targetId, message }) => {
socket.to(targetId).emit('message:private', {
from: socket.id,
message,
});
});
socket.on('disconnect', () => {
console.log(`User disconnected: ${socket.id}`);
});
});
Python FastAPI WebSocket
from fastapi import FastAPI, WebSocket, WebSocketDisconnect
from typing import Dict, Set
app = FastAPI()
rooms: Dict[str, Set[WebSocket]] = {}
@app.websocket("/ws/{room_id}")
async def websocket_endpoint(websocket: WebSocket, room_id: str):
await websocket.accept()
if room_id not in rooms:
rooms[room_id] = set()
rooms[room_id].add(websocket)
try:
while True:
data = await websocket.receive_json()
# 广播给房间内其他人
for ws in rooms[room_id]:
if ws != websocket:
await ws.send_json(data)
except WebSocketDisconnect:
rooms[room_id].remove(websocket)
消息协议
{
"type": "chat | system | ack | error",
"payload": {},
"timestamp": 1704067200000,
"id": "uuid"
}
